home *** CD-ROM | disk | FTP | other *** search
/ AMOS PD CD / amospdcd.iso / sourcecode / demos / how_many_bobs.amos / how_many_bobs.amosSourceCode < prev    next >
AMOS Source Code  |  1991-05-17  |  1KB  |  38 lines

  1. '***************************************************************************** 
  2. '*                                                                           *   
  3. '*           HOW MANY BOBS? WRITTEN BY STEVE BENNETT IN JANUARY 91           * 
  4. '*                                                                           *   
  5. '*     Well syntex beat me to showing off this routine but its still ace.    *     
  6. '*                                                                           *   
  7. '***************************************************************************** 
  8. Led Off 
  9. Degree 
  10. For T=0 To 4
  11.    Screen Open T,320,256,16,Lowres
  12.    Flash Off : Hide On 
  13.    Get Sprite Palette 
  14.    Cls 0
  15. Next T
  16. NUMBER=14
  17. Music 1
  18. HERE:
  19. T=-90 : A=0 : OFFSET=180
  20. Repeat 
  21.    Inc A : If A=5 Then A=0
  22.    If OFFSET=0 Then OFFSET=-90
  23.    If OFFSET=-180
  24.       Repeat 
  25.          For R=1 To 50 : For T=4 To 0 Step -1 : Wait Vbl : Screen To Front T : Next T : Next R
  26.          For R=1 To 50 : For T=0 To 4 : Wait Vbl : Screen To Front T : Next T : Next R
  27.       Until Mouse Key
  28.    End If 
  29.    Wait Vbl 
  30.    Screen To Front A : Screen A
  31.    Paste Bob T-20,(Sin(T+20)*OFFSET+100),NUMBER
  32.    Paste Bob 80,110,11
  33.    Inc T : Inc T : If T=340 : T=-90 : For J=1 To 10 : Dec OFFSET : Dec OFFSET : Dec OFFSET : Next J : Inc NUMBER : End If 
  34.    If NUMBER=18 Then NUMBER=14
  35. Until Mouse Click
  36. Input NUMBER
  37. For T=0 To 4 : Screen T : Cls 0 : Next T
  38. Goto HERE